Founding Backend Engineer
Indexed description
No visa sponsorship is available — candidates must be legally authorized to work in Sweden.
What You'll Do
- Operate with founder-level ownership across the full backend stack — from database migrations to context engineering.
- Build and iterate on LLM flows, including prompt engineering, context design, and tool integrations.
- Lead infrastructure work focused on GCP migration, scalability, and performance.
- Make architectural decisions autonomously, aligning with the team through execution and shared goals.
- Contribute to hiring and help establish early engineering culture and standards.
